Circular RNAs: biogenesis, expression and their potential roles in reproduction
Abstract Unlike other non-coding RNAs (ncRNAs), circular RNA (circRNA) is generally presented as a covalently linked circle lacking both a 5′ cap and a 3′ tail. circRNAs were thought to be spliced intermediates, byproducts, or products of abnormal RNA splicing events.
